The Science of Music and Mental Health

Research has demonstrated that music helps to increase the release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asurable experiences, in the brain. Similarly, studies have found that listening to music can activate the same brain regions that are involved in emotion regulation. This means that music can help to regulate and stabilize our moods, reducing feelings of anxiety and depression.

Additionally, music has been found to reduce stress levels by lowering the stress hormone cortisol in the brain. When we listen to music, our heart rate and blood pressure decrease, making us feel more relaxed and at ease. As a result, listening to music has been shown to be an effective tool in stress management.

The Benefits of Music Therapy

Music therapy is a form of treatment that incorporates music into the healing process. It has been found to be effective in treating a variety of mental health conditions, including depression, anxiety, and PTSD. Music therapy is typically administered by a trained professional who uses music to help people cope with their emotions and reduce symptoms of mental illness.

One of the benefits of music therapy is that it can be tailored to an individual’s specific needs and preferences. For example, someone who is struggling with anxiety may benefit from listening to calming music, while someone who is experiencing depression may find more benefit from listening to uplifting and motivating music.

The Power of Music in Everyday Life

While music therapy is a powerful tool in mental health treatment, the benefits of music can also be experienced in our everyday lives. Incorporating music into our daily routines can help to reduce stress, boost our mood, and improve our overall well-being.

For example, listening to music during exercise can enhance our performance and increase our motivation. Playing music while we work can help us to focus and be more productive. And listening to relaxing music before bed can improve the quality of our sleep.
